UD hosts Policy and Practice Institute for nearly 600 Delaware educators with state and local partners

In partnership with the Delaware Department of Education (DDOE) and the Delaware Association of School Administrators, the University of Delaware's School Success Center (SSC) and Partnership for Public Education (PPE), housed within the College of Education and Human Development (CEHD), welcomed nearly 600 educators to the 22nd annual Policy and Practice Institute in June at Dover High School in Dover, Delaware.

The conference is Delaware's premier networking and professional learning event for educators, school leaders and policymakers. With practical tools and resources, this year's event enabled participants to take action toward creating stronger and more equitable learning opportunities for Delaware students. With sessions focused on building school, family and community partnerships, recruiting and retaining educators and more, the conference aligned with CEHD's commitment to supporting Delaware educators, improving educational outcomes and diversifying the education workforce.

"The increase in attendance this year and the number and variety of sessions demonstrates the importance of this annual event to Delaware educators," said Faith Muirhead, director of the SSC. "We are honored to collaborate in bringing educators together to learn with and from one another. This was a year to celebrate, moving from intention to impact, and the conference theme clearly resonated with participants."
